Charging System Failing Again? 120-130

Sorry about the sparks. Insofar as the heat is concerned, all the LHD b18/b20 Volvos had it that way so it shouldn't be a real concern. Since the fan on the alternator draws air from the rear of the unit, you could rig a shield so it has to draw air from the front rather than the rear, if you felt it were necessary.

I didn't check your previous posts... were the brushes worn? If they were replaced, the insulation between the contacts on the commutator needs to be trimmed down too. Probably much easier to just get a rebuilt unit.
